@import"https://fonts.googleapis.com/css2?family=Anton&family=Space+Mono:wght@400;700&family=DM+Sans:wght@300;400;500;600&display=swap";.nav[data-astro-cid-dmqpwcec]{position:fixed;top:0;left:0;right:0;z-index:100;height:var(--nav-height);transition:background .4s var(--ease-out),border-color .4s var(--ease-out);border-bottom:1px solid transparent}.nav[data-astro-cid-dmqpwcec].is-scrolled{background:#000000eb;back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px);border-bottom-color:var(--color-border)}.nav__inner[data-astro-cid-dmqpwcec]{display:flex;align-items:center;justify-content:space-between;height:100%;padding-right:0}.nav__logo[data-astro-cid-dmqpwcec]{display:flex;align-items:center}.nav__logo-img[data-astro-cid-dmqpwcec]{height:36px;width:auto;display:block;transition:opacity .25s var(--ease-out)}.nav__logo[data-astro-cid-dmqpwcec]:hover .nav__logo-img[data-astro-cid-dmqpwcec]{opacity:.75}.nav__actions[data-astro-cid-dmqpwcec]{display:flex;align-items:center;gap:var(--space-md);margin-right:calc(-2 * var(--space-md))}.nav__reservas-link[data-astro-cid-dmqpwcec]{font-family:var(--font-body);font-size:.7rem;font-weight:600;letter-spacing:.25em;text-transform:uppercase;color:var(--color-yellow);border:1px solid rgba(186,217,0,.4);border-radius:999px;padding:6px 16px;transition:color .25s var(--ease-out),background .25s var(--ease-out),border-color .25s var(--ease-out)}@media(hover:hover)and (pointer:fine){.nav__reservas-link[data-astro-cid-dmqpwcec]:hover{background:var(--color-yellow);color:var(--color-black);border-color:var(--color-yellow)}}.nav__reservas-link[data-astro-cid-dmqpwcec]:active{transform:scale(.97)}.nav__menu-btn[data-astro-cid-dmqpwcec]{background:none;border:none;font-family:var(--font-body);font-size:1rem;font-weight:600;letter-spacing:.3em;text-transform:uppercase;color:var(--color-text-secondary);cursor:none;padding:8px 0;transition:color .25s var(--ease-out);position:relative}.nav__menu-btn[data-astro-cid-dmqpwcec]:after{content:"";position:absolute;bottom:4px;left:0;width:0;height:1px;background:var(--color-white);transition:width .3s var(--ease-out)}@media(hover:hover)and (pointer:fine){.nav__menu-btn[data-astro-cid-dmqpwcec]:hover{color:var(--color-white)}.nav__menu-btn[data-astro-cid-dmqpwcec]:hover:after{width:100%}}.nav__menu-btn[data-astro-cid-dmqpwcec]:active{transform:scale(.96)}.nav__fullscreen[data-astro-cid-dmqpwcec]{position:fixed;inset:0;background:var(--color-black);z-index:200;display:flex;flex-direction:column;opacity:0;pointer-events:none;transform:translateY(-6px);transition:opacity .35s var(--ease-out),transform .35s var(--ease-out)}.nav__fullscreen[data-astro-cid-dmqpwcec].is-open{opacity:1;pointer-events:all;transform:translateY(0)}.nav__fullscreen-header[data-astro-cid-dmqpwcec]{display:flex;align-items:center;justify-content:space-between;height:var(--nav-height);flex-shrink:0;border-bottom:1px solid var(--color-border)}.nav__close-btn[data-astro-cid-dmqpwcec]{background:none;border:none;font-family:var(--font-body);font-size:.7rem;font-weight:600;letter-spacing:.25em;text-transform:uppercase;color:var(--color-text-secondary);cursor:none;display:flex;align-items:center;gap:.3em;transition:color .25s var(--ease-out)}@media(hover:hover)and (pointer:fine){.nav__close-btn[data-astro-cid-dmqpwcec]:hover{color:var(--color-white)}.nav__close-btn[data-astro-cid-dmqpwcec]:hover .nav__close-bracket[data-astro-cid-dmqpwcec]{color:var(--color-text-secondary)}}.nav__close-btn[data-astro-cid-dmqpwcec]:active{transform:scale(.96)}.nav__close-bracket[data-astro-cid-dmqpwcec]{color:var(--color-text-tertiary);transition:color .25s var(--ease-out)}.nav__fullscreen-body[data-astro-cid-dmqpwcec]{flex:1;display:flex;align-items:flex-end;padding-bottom:var(--space-xl)}.nav__fullscreen-links[data-astro-cid-dmqpwcec]{list-style:none;display:flex;flex-direction:column;gap:0}.nav__fullscreen-item[data-astro-cid-dmqpwcec]{overflow:hidden}.nav__fullscreen-link[data-astro-cid-dmqpwcec]{font-family:var(--font-display);font-size:clamp(3.5rem,9vw,8rem);line-height:1.05;color:var(--color-text-secondary);display:block;position:relative;transform:translateY(105%);transition:color .2s var(--ease-out),transform .65s var(--ease-out)}.nav-link__text[data-astro-cid-dmqpwcec]{display:block}.nav-link__echo[data-astro-cid-dmqpwcec]{position:absolute;top:0;left:0;opacity:.15;transform:translateY(5px) translate(4px);pointer-events:none;user-select:none}.nav__fullscreen[data-astro-cid-dmqpwcec].is-open .nav__fullscreen-link[data-astro-cid-dmqpwcec]{transform:translateY(0);transition-delay:calc(var(--i) * .1s + .1s)}.nav__fullscreen[data-astro-cid-dmqpwcec].is-closing{opacity:0;pointer-events:none;transform:translateY(0);transition:opacity .3s var(--ease-out) .35s}.nav__fullscreen[data-astro-cid-dmqpwcec].is-closing .nav__fullscreen-link[data-astro-cid-dmqpwcec]{transform:translateY(105%);transition:transform .45s var(--ease-in);transition-delay:calc(var(--i) * .05s)}@media(hover:hover)and (pointer:fine){.nav__fullscreen-link[data-astro-cid-dmqpwcec]:hover{color:var(--color-white)}}.nav__fullscreen-link--active[data-astro-cid-dmqpwcec]{color:var(--color-white)}.footer[data-astro-cid-sz7xmlte]{background:var(--color-black)}.footer__main[data-astro-cid-sz7xmlte]{display:flex;align-items:center;justify-content:space-between;padding:28px 0}.footer__socials[data-astro-cid-sz7xmlte]{display:flex;align-items:center;gap:1.5rem;list-style:none}.footer__social-link[data-astro-cid-sz7xmlte]{display:flex;align-items:center;justify-content:center;color:var(--color-text-secondary);transition:color .25s var(--ease-out)}.footer__social-link[data-astro-cid-sz7xmlte]:hover{color:var(--color-yellow)}.footer__reservas[data-astro-cid-sz7xmlte]{position:relative;color:var(--color-white);font-family:var(--font-display);font-size:clamp(2rem,4vw,3.5rem);letter-spacing:.1em;line-height:1;transition:color .25s var(--ease-out)}.footer__reservas[data-astro-cid-sz7xmlte]:after{content:"";position:absolute;bottom:-6px;left:0;width:0;height:2px;background:var(--color-yellow);transition:width .35s var(--ease-out)}.footer__reservas[data-astro-cid-sz7xmlte]:hover{color:var(--color-yellow)}.footer__reservas[data-astro-cid-sz7xmlte]:hover:after{width:100%}.footer__bottom[data-astro-cid-sz7xmlte]{border-top:1px solid var(--color-border)}.footer__bottom-inner[data-astro-cid-sz7xmlte]{display:flex;align-items:center;justify-content:space-between;padding:12px 0}.footer__copy[data-astro-cid-sz7xmlte],.footer__credit[data-astro-cid-sz7xmlte]{color:var(--color-text-tertiary);font-family:var(--font-body);font-size:.65rem;letter-spacing:.05em}@media(max-width:600px){.footer__main[data-astro-cid-sz7xmlte]{flex-direction:column;gap:var(--space-sm);padding:24px 0}.footer__bottom-inner[data-astro-cid-sz7xmlte]{flex-direction:column;gap:6px;text-align:center;padding:12px 0}.footer__socials[data-astro-cid-sz7xmlte]{gap:1.2rem;flex-wrap:wrap;justify-content:center}}.cursor[data-astro-cid-msvfyisy]{pointer-events:none;position:fixed;inset:0;z-index:9999}.cursor__dot[data-astro-cid-msvfyisy]{position:fixed;width:10px;height:10px;background:var(--color-yellow);border-radius:50%;transform:translate(-50%,-50%);transition:width .2s var(--ease-out),height .2s var(--ease-out),opacity .15s;will-change:transform}.cursor__ring[data-astro-cid-msvfyisy]{position:fixed;width:40px;height:40px;border:1.5px solid rgba(186,217,0,.6);border-radius:50%;transform:translate(-50%,-50%);transition:width .3s var(--ease-out),height .3s var(--ease-out),border-color .3s var(--ease-out),opacity .2s;will-change:transform}.cursor--hover[data-astro-cid-msvfyisy] .cursor__dot[data-astro-cid-msvfyisy]{width:6px;height:6px}.cursor--hover[data-astro-cid-msvfyisy] .cursor__ring[data-astro-cid-msvfyisy]{width:60px;height:60px;border-color:var(--color-yellow);background:var(--color-yellow-dim)}.cursor--hidden[data-astro-cid-msvfyisy] .cursor__dot[data-astro-cid-msvfyisy],.cursor--hidden[data-astro-cid-msvfyisy] .cursor__ring[data-astro-cid-msvfyisy]{opacity:0}@keyframes astroFadeInOut{0%{opacity:1}to{opacity:0}}@keyframes astroFadeIn{0%{opacity:0;mix-blend-mode:plus-lighter}to{opacity:1;mix-blend-mode:plus-lighter}}@keyframes astroFadeOut{0%{opacity:1;mix-blend-mode:plus-lighter}to{opacity:0;mix-blend-mode:plus-lighter}}@keyframes astroSlideFromRight{0%{transform:translate(100%)}}@keyframes astroSlideFromLeft{0%{transform:translate(-100%)}}@keyframes astroSlideToRight{to{transform:translate(100%)}}@keyframes astroSlideToLeft{to{transform:translate(-100%)}}@media(prefers-reduced-motion){::view-transition-group(*),::view-transition-old(*),::view-transition-new(*){animation:none!important}[data-astro-transition-scope]{animation:none!important}}.astro-route-announcer{position:absolute;left:0;top:0;clip:rect(0 0 0 0);clip-path:inset(50%);overflow:hidden;white-space:nowrap;width:1px;height:1px}:root{--color-black: #000000;--color-white: #ffffff;--color-yellow: #bad900;--color-yellow-dim: rgba(186, 217, 0, .15);--color-yellow-glow: rgba(186, 217, 0, .06);--color-surface: #0a0a0a;--color-surface-2: #111111;--color-surface-3: #1a1a1a;--color-border: rgba(255, 255, 255, .08);--color-border-hover: rgba(186, 217, 0, .4);--color-text-primary: #ffffff;--color-text-secondary: rgba(255, 255, 255, .5);--color-text-tertiary: rgba(255, 255, 255, .25);--color-gray-mid: #aaaaaa;--color-gray-light: #e5e5e5;--font-display: "Anton", sans-serif;--font-body: "Space Mono", monospace;--font-sans: "DM Sans", sans-serif;--space-xs: .5rem;--space-sm: 1rem;--space-md: 2rem;--space-lg: 4rem;--space-xl: 8rem;--space-2xl: 12rem;--ease-out: cubic-bezier(.16, 1, .3, 1);--ease-in: cubic-bezier(.4, 0, 1, 1);--ease-inout: cubic-bezier(.65, 0, .35, 1);--nav-height: 72px;--container-max: 1440px}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{font-size:16px;scroll-behavior:smooth;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body{background-color:var(--color-black);color:var(--color-text-primary);font-family:var(--font-body);font-weight:400;line-height:1.6;cursor:none;overflow-x:hidden}h1{font-family:var(--font-display);font-size:clamp(4rem,12vw,11rem);line-height:.9;letter-spacing:.02em;text-transform:uppercase}h2{font-family:var(--font-display);font-size:clamp(2.5rem,6vw,6rem);line-height:.95;letter-spacing:.02em;text-transform:uppercase}h3{font-family:var(--font-display);font-size:clamp(1.5rem,3vw,2.5rem);line-height:1;letter-spacing:.02em;text-transform:uppercase}p{font-size:1rem;line-height:1.7;color:var(--color-text-secondary)}a{color:inherit;text-decoration:none}img,video{display:block;max-width:100%}.container{width:100%;max-width:var(--container-max);margin-inline:auto;padding-inline:var(--space-md)}@media(max-width:768px){.container{padding-inline:var(--space-sm)}}.label{font-family:var(--font-sans);font-size:.7rem;font-weight:500;letter-spacing:.2em;text-transform:uppercase;color:var(--color-text-secondary)}.label--yellow{color:var(--color-yellow)}.accent-line{display:block;width:40px;height:2px;background-color:var(--color-yellow)}.reveal{opacity:0;transform:translateY(18px);filter:blur(4px);transition:opacity 1s var(--ease-out),transform 1s var(--ease-out),filter .75s var(--ease-out)}.reveal.is-visible{opacity:1;transform:translateY(0);filter:blur(0px)}.page-transition{animation:fadeIn .4s var(--ease-out) both}@keyframes fadeIn{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}@media(prefers-reduced-motion:reduce){*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important}html{scroll-behavior:auto}}::view-transition-old(root),::view-transition-new(root){animation:none}#page-canvas{position:fixed;inset:0;z-index:9998;pointer-events:none;width:100dvw;height:100dvh}
